Transaction 38c74340eb91f15c3fd9ccf2f922877081cc58ea1a8d7a2ff01a5c04666aa90a

1 Input
2 Outputs
  • 38c74340eb91f15c3fd9ccf2f922877081cc58ea1a8d7a2ff01a5c04666aa90a:0
  • value  71703
    address  1ELwRo8HqPeV9B7EuUWvo4SBzMhhSc2mdW
  • 38c74340eb91f15c3fd9ccf2f922877081cc58ea1a8d7a2ff01a5c04666aa90a:1
  • value  3316469011
    address  bc1qnsupj8eqya02nm8v6tmk93zslu2e2z8chlmcej